Output ed81cc2b59d140e0b3a8981720e5308c609fa812da14a87d93e8270a8f418146:3

value
3700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f85f343523b2c8f469974c5bd3d22b5a061e4490 OP_EQUAL
address
AF5YHrCfr7zouznHbKC3HrmY76NKJPt9Ey
transaction
ed81cc2b59d140e0b3a8981720e5308c609fa812da14a87d93e8270a8f418146